How Much Does it Cost to Move from Orlando to Sacramento?

Moving a 1 bedroom apartment 2,931 miles from Orlando, FL to Sacramento, CA will cost on average $4,274 to hire full service movers. A 3 bedroom Orlando to Sacramento move is roughly $10,337.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by type of move and home size. Pricing will vary based upon the exact locations of pickup and dropoff as well as several other factors. The most important pricing component that is often overlooked is how far away the move date is. The earlier you can reserve movers, the better your pricing and options will be.

Home SizeMoving CostVolume of Packed Items (ft³)$/ft³
Studio$2,864300 ft³$9.55
1 Bedroom$4,274450 ft³$9.50
2 Bedrooms$7,085750 ft³$9.45
3 Bedrooms$10,3371100 ft³$9.40
4 Bedrooms$14,9551600 ft³$9.35
5+ Bedrooms$16,7351800 ft³$9.30
*Please note: These Florida to California moving prices are rough approximations based upon nationwide data as well as local and statewide data from Florida & California. The volume listed here represents the estimated cubic footage of your household items when packed and loaded into a moving truck. To determine the exact costs associated with your move, get a quote from a licensed FL to CA mover.

When you relocate from Orlando to Sacramento, you swap the familiar theme park horizons and lush, green landscapes for a city rich in cultural diversity and abundant local agriculture. Sacramento's Midtown area, for instance, is bustling with farm-to-table restaurants like Mulvaney's B&L, and thriving local markets like the Midtown Farmers Market, underscoring the city's strong farm-to-fork ethos. The varied topography around Sacramento, from the rolling hills of the Sierra Nevada to the expansive Sacramento-San Joaquin River Delta, offers residents a blend of outdoor leisure and adventure, contrasting with Orlando's predominantly flat landscape. While you might miss the immediate beach access and warmer winters of Orlando, Sacramento's proximity to both the Pacific coastline and ski resorts offers a unique balance, ensuring there's always something memorable to explore.

In Orlando, the blend of modern and Spanish architecture reflects the city's vibrant culture and history. Homes often boast amenities like pools and are situated in gated communities, catering to a more suburban lifestyle. On the other hand, Sacramento's housing leans towards ranch and Craftsman styles, with listings frequently highlighting energy-efficient features, large yards, and close proximity to parks. This difference in architectural style and home features points toward Sacramento's emphasis on an eco-friendly and family-oriented lifestyle. Despite Sacramento having a slightly higher median home price and rent than Orlando, its urban lifestyle score is also higher, indicating a more densely packed, community-focused environment.

In evaluating the weather differences between Orlando, FL, and Sacramento, CA, you'll notice a significant shift in humidity and sunshine days. Orlando's higher humidity might have you accustomed to a muggier climate, whereas Sacramento's lower humidity levels offer a drier warmth, which can feel more comfortable for many. Additionally, the increase in sunny days in Sacramento means more opportunities to enjoy the outdoors. Taking these factors into account will help you adjust your lifestyle and wardrobe appropriately for your new home in Sacramento.

Transitioning from Orlando to Sacramento, you'll notice differences financially, notably in average incomes and living expenses. While Sacramento boasts a higher average household income, this is counterbalanced by its higher cost of living and state income tax, not present in Florida. Property and sales taxes also vary, potentially affecting your budgeting. Furthermore, each city's leading industries reflect unique job opportunities and economic dynamics. Thus, while Sacramento may appear more affluent on paper, considerations such as taxes and the cost of living are key factors in evaluating the economic landscape of your new home.

In Orlando, the average commute time is slightly higher compared to Sacramento, where the traffic is a bit more manageable, which might have a small but noticeable impact on your daily life. Orlando's public transit options are not as robust as Sacramento's, making it more challenging to get around without a car. In contrast, Sacramento offers more public transportation options, making it feasibly easier to navigate the city without personal vehicle dependence. These differences could significantly affect your choice of neighborhood, daily routines, and overall lifestyle in your new city.
